JMS之ActiveMQ(一):安装

JMS即Java消息服务(Java Message Service)应用程序接口,是一个Java平台中关于面向消息中间件(MOM:Message Oriented Middleware)的API,用于在两个应用程序之间,或分布式系统中发送消息,进行异步通信。Java消息服务是一个与具体平台无关的API,绝大多数MOM提供商都对JMS提供支持。

JMS对象模型图(规范):


ActiveMQ就是实现了JMS的一种Provider,是目前非常流行的一个消息中间件,从http://activemq.apache.org/activemq-5154-release.html下载最新稳定版本的ActiveMQ,解压后目录结构如下(Windows版本):


点击bin下的win64下的activemq.bat,启动它(前提是jdk安装配置好)


启动完成后,访问http://localhost:8161/admin/,用户名密码默认都为admin,如下图,启动成功了。


linux下安装

复制apache-activemq-5.14.0-bin.tar.gz到/usr/local目录下

进入/usr/local目录

扫描二维码关注公众号,回复: 1840725 查看本文章

解压压缩文件:tar xvf apache-activemq-5.14.0-bin.tar.gz


进入apache-activemq-5.14.0bin下,执行./activemq start 启动(./activemq stop关闭 ./activemq status查看activemq的运行状态),查询当前虚拟机的IP地址


打开web管理页面http://192.168.254.128:8161/admin,显示如下页面,activemq启动成功!


注意事项:远程访问云服务器的activemq,必须要开启防火墙端口8161(web管理页面端口)和61616(activemq服务监控端口)


猜你喜欢

转载自blog.csdn.net/qq_23543983/article/details/80482047